(9) MFC640CW/820CW, European/Oceanian/Asian models The thermal conductor rubber is
attached to the solder side of the main PCB. When replacing the main PCB, gently remove the
thermal conductor rubber from the main PCB and attach it to a new PCB. (For details, see the
reassembling notes below.)
(10) Pull the WLAN PCB up and out of the lower cover.

Reassembling Notes
• MFC640CW/820CW, European/Oceanian/Asian models If the main PCB is replaced, attach
the thermal conductor rubber removed from the old PCB to a new one as specified below.

• When securing the main PCB and its shield frame, first tighten four screws "d" and "e" and then
screw "c." See the previous page.
